Humble Pie

Eating humble pie is like eating liver.  It does not taste very good, but it’s good for you.

Some facts about humble pie:

  • Ego and humble pie do not mix.  They are like oil and water.
  • Ingredients are:
    • Wisdom
    • Love
    • Patience
    • Humility
  • It can only be served in relationships.  You can’t eat it alone.
  • After eating it, you will feel good.
  • The more you eat, the wiser you get.
  • It’s a nutrient dense super-food for your mind.

When the greater good is at stake, when your ego is stoking you to fight, it’s better to use the benefit of time, patience and love and eat some humble pie.

Warning:  This will feel awkward at first.

However, when it becomes habit, you’ll wonder how you lived without it.
